Shingō is a village located in Aomori Prefecture, Japan. As of 28 February 2023, the village has an estimated population of 2,192 in 895 households and a population density of 15 persons per km2. The total area of the village is 150.77 square kilometres.

Towada-Hachimantai National Park is a large national park in the Tohoku region of Japan, straddling the prefectures of Akita, Aomori and Iwate.
